The Health and Human Services Commission (HHSC) is soliciting competitive bids under Invitation for Bids HHS0017360 for the installation, removal, maintenance, and repair of gates at the Rio Grande State Supported Living Center in Harlingen, Texas. The scope includes installing 14 walk gates and 7 track gates with varying dimensions, along with 103 linear feet of cement beam with one-inch mesh, requiring all labor, materials, tools, equipment, and transportation to be furnished by the contractor. Work must comply with manufacturer specifications, use only commercial-grade and new materials, and adhere to strict quality control standards, including continuous personal inspection by the contractor and supervisor. The contract will commence upon award and expire on August 31, 2026, with no automatic renewals, though HHSC retains the option to extend the term for up to one additional year subject to funding availability. Services must be performed Monday through Friday, 8 a.m. to 5 p.m. Central Time, with a four-hour response time required for service calls unless extended by the contract manager. The solicitation allows for both HHSC and the Department of State Health Services (DSHS) to utilize the resulting contract. All bids must be submitted via email, the HHS Online Bid Room, or physical delivery on a single USB drive by June 5, 2026, at 10:30 a.m. Central Time, with no facsimile or alternative submission methods accepted. Proposals must include completed Exhibits A through F, a Public Information Act Copy, Form 1295 for interested parties, and adherence to pricing requirements outlined in Exhibit C using firm, fixed prices for the contract life, with all-inclusive unit pricing covering everything from labor to incidental costs. Pricing is evaluated alongside technical compliance, delivery capability, and contractor experience to determine best value, not necessarily the lowest bid. Contractors must provide 24-hour emergency contacts, employ personnel aged 18 or older with industry-specific training, pass comprehensive background checks including criminal and sex offender registry screenings, and carry primary workers’ compensation insurance with employer liability limits of $1,000,000 per accident and per employee. Insurance must name HHSC as an additional insured, and contractors are fully liable for personnel safety, facility access compliance, and prohibition against duplicating keys or access cards.
